Watch Germany’s Marco Koch Nail 2:07.69 200 Breast At Euro Meet

On day 3 of the 2016 Euro Meet, Germany’s Marco Koch blasted the fastest 200m breaststroke in the world this season. After a sub-30-second opening 50, Koch turned at the 100m mark in 1:01.78 before ultimately touching the wall for a final time of 2:07.69.

That mark checks in as the 11th swiftest swim of all time and even surpasses the 2:07.76 time Koch registered at the 2015 FINA World Championships to claim the gold.
